LASSBio-1359 is an adenosine receptor agonist. It acts by inducing relaxation of corpus cavernosum. It is also acts as a novel selective phosphodiesterase-.

MedKoo Cat#: 562402

Name: LASSBio-1359

CAS#: 1396397-19-5

Chemical Formula: C17H18N2O3

Exact Mass: 298.1317

Molecular Weight: 298.34

Elemental Analysis: C, 68.44; H, 6.08; N, 9.39; O, 16.09
